#4e245c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4e245c is composed of 30.6% red, 14.1% green and 36.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15.2% cyan, 60.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 63.9% black. It has a hue angle of 285 degrees, a saturation of 43.8% and a lightness of 25.1%. #4e245c color hex could be obtained by blending #9c48b8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

Shades and Tints of #4e245c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060307 is the darkest color, while #fbf8f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#4e245c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#423d43 is the less saturated color, while #5f027e is the most saturated one.
